Output 593dd3abcb97adb656b43f872d9f192698c98b71508a2fe1a7f3c91bdf00091f:0

value
75835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 057ef1b5f40c224b3ea3b052b7ad56a640b3c017 OP_EQUAL
address
32C5NjqQg6oY3pZUNdGP4U91hyuoreCkbb
transaction
593dd3abcb97adb656b43f872d9f192698c98b71508a2fe1a7f3c91bdf00091f